| Commit message (Collapse) | Author | Age | Files | Lines | |
|---|---|---|---|---|---|
| * | Initial commit | Kieran Cawthray | 2023-11-11 | 1 | -1/+1 |
| | | |||||
| * | navigation: Move font to external memory (#1838) | JF | 2023-09-02 | 3 | -12/+15 |
| | | | | | | | | | | | The TTF font used by the navigation app is ~20KB and is stored in internal flash memory. To free this space, the TTF font is now converted in 2 "atlas pictures" (pictures that contain multiple concatenated images) stored in the external flash memory. The navigation app now accesses one of those 2 files and apply an offset to display the desired picture. The corresponding documentation has also been updated. Add comments about the layout of the pictures that contain the icon and about the indexing of those icons. In documentation (buildAndProgram.md), edit the section about the debug compilation mode. Remove the part about removing the Navigation app to free some memory (since it's not relevant anymore) and explain how to selectively build parts of the firmware in Debug mode. | ||||
| * | PineTimeStyle weather display (#1459) | kieranc | 2023-06-04 | 2 | -2/+12 |
| | | | | | | Weather display for PineTimeStyle Documentation : https://wiki.pine64.org/wiki/PineTimeStyle and https://wiki.pine64.org/wiki/Infinitime-Weather | ||||
| * | fonts: Make patching silent | Finlay Davidson | 2023-04-16 | 1 | -1/+1 |
| | | | | | The generate script should only output anything if there are errors. | ||||
| * | motion: Disable Motion app | Riku Isokoski | 2023-02-25 | 1 | -1/+1 |
| | | | | | | This is a debugging app, not useful for most people. Also remove the app icon. | ||||
| * | Revert "prepare cmake unity build" | Riku Isokoski | 2022-12-31 | 1 | -6/+0 |
| | | | | | This reverts commit 21f3bd708261ece47096961039e65d5b6f113c73. | ||||
| * | prepare cmake unity build | tnixeu | 2022-12-27 | 1 | -0/+6 |
| | | | | | Exclude files from unity build which currently cause compile erros because of redefinitions. | ||||
| * | Merge remote-tracking branch 'upstream/develop' into pts-options | Kieran Cawthray | 2022-09-05 | 2 | -18/+18 |
| |\ | |||||
| | * | Add sleep mode which disables notifications, touch- and motion wakeup (#1261) | Riku Isokoski | 2022-08-21 | 1 | -1/+1 |
| | | | |||||
| | * | Fix markdown format with autoformatter (#1284) | Riku Isokoski | 2022-08-21 | 1 | -16/+16 |
| | | | |||||
| | * | Improve checkbox visibility (#1266) | Riku Isokoski | 2022-08-16 | 1 | -1/+1 |
| | | | |||||
| * | | Initial mockup | Kieran Cawthray | 2022-08-05 | 1 | -1/+1 |
| |/ | |||||
| * | Replace icomoon system font with material design icons (#1228) | Riku Isokoski | 2022-07-21 | 6 | -43692/+212 |
| | | |||||
| * | Font generation: Fix patch binary path | Christoph Honal | 2022-06-25 | 1 | -1/+1 |
| | | |||||
| * | Patch hole in the letter M in jetbrains_mono_bold_20 (#1175) | Riku Isokoski | 2022-06-16 | 3 | -1/+11 |
| | | |||||
| * | Remove duplicated value in fonts.json (#1179) | Diego Miguel Lozano | 2022-06-11 | 1 | -1/+1 |
| | | |||||
| * | Lighten the large font for a more balanced look | Riku Isokoski | 2022-06-06 | 2 | -1/+1 |
| | | | | | Add Jetbrains Mono Light font | ||||
| * | Add initial counter widget | Riku Isokoski | 2022-06-06 | 1 | -1/+1 |
| | | |||||
| * | remove unused symbols, free a little bit of space (#1167) | mabuch | 2022-06-05 | 1 | -1/+1 |
| | | |||||
| * | Fix various typos | luz paz | 2022-06-05 | 1 | -1/+1 |
| | | | | | Found via `codespell -q 3 -S ./src/libs -L ans,doubleclick,trough` | ||||
| * | fonts: gen.py: clearify missing exe message | Reinhold Gschweicher | 2022-05-16 | 1 | -1/+1 |
| | | |||||
| * | generalize lv-font creation | Reinhold Gschweicher | 2022-05-16 | 2 | -17/+34 |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| In https://github.com/InfiniTimeOrg/InfiniTime/pull/1097 new font generation capabilites were added. Generalize the font creation to make it possible to reuse the `displayapp/fonts/CMakeLists.txt` file for `InfiniSim` and just add the new cmake file to the project and link against the new `infinitime_fonts` target. In the following a list of changes. Allow non-global installed `lv_font_conv` executable installed with ```sh npm install lv_font_conv@1.5.2 ``` In CMake we search for `lv_font_conv` executable. Add the found executable to the python script `generate.py`, to remove the need for `lv_font_conv` to be in the path. Search for `python3` executable, if CMake version 3.12 is available. Otherwise use `python` as hard coded executable. Instead of adding the generated fonts to `SOURCE_FILES` variable, create a static library `infinitime_fonts`. Link this library to the executables instead. Use `add_custom_target()` together with `add_custom_command()` to generate the font.c files once (like the original PR does). | ||||
| * | fontgen: update README.md to remove patch advanced options |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-1/+1 |
| | | |||||
| * | fontgen: changes to allow CMake to work from other project |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-4/+4 |
| | | |||||
| * | fontgen: remove advanced (format string, process as list) from patching | Yehoshua Pesach Wallach | 2022-05-10 | 2 | -13/+2 |
| | | |||||
| * | fontgen: verify lv_font_conv at cmake |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-1/+1 |
| | | |||||
| * | fontgen: remove double-asterisk in readme |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-1/+1 |
| | | |||||
| * | fontgen: assume plain .patch for single string patch | Yehoshua Pesach Wallach | 2022-05-10 | 2 | -5/+12 |
| | | |||||
| * | fotngen: check for lv_font_conv |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-0/+3 |
| | | |||||
| * | fontgen: remove "feature" feature | Yehoshua Pesach Wallach | 2022-05-10 | 3 | -15/+1 |
| | | |||||
| * | fontgen: remove "generating the fonts" section |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-7/+0 |
| | | |||||
| * | fontgen: move lv_font_conv doc |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-6/+1 |
| | | |||||
| * | fontgen: generate font .c files in build dir | Yehoshua Pesach Wallach | 2022-05-10 | 2 | -4/+9 |
| | | |||||
| * | fontgen: generate fonts at runtime with CMake | Yehoshua Pesach Wallach | 2022-05-10 | 8 | -6890/+16 |
| | | |||||
| * | fonts: update README.md to match new method |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-74/+20 |
| | | |||||
| * | fontgen: simplfy json after removed external features key | Yehoshua Pesach Wallach | 2022-05-10 | 2 | -93/+95 |
| | | |||||
| * | fontgen: minor changes |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-2/+2 |
| | | |||||
| * | fontgen: remove .c from requested font if there |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-2/+5 |
| | | |||||
| * | fontgen: simplify enabled fonts |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-7/+6 |
| | | |||||
| * | fontgen: use patch file for jetbrains 0 fix | Yehoshua Pesach Wallach | 2022-05-10 | 3 | -31/+7 |
| | | |||||
| * | fontgen: removed ability of removing .c ext |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-8/+0 |
| | | |||||
| * | fontgen: move features into fonts | Yehoshua Pesach Wallach | 2022-05-10 | 2 | -21/+13 |
| | | | | | | | Also, removed feature existance cheking (since it now depends on a font, so may end up being inside (only) a font not being used currently - which is an allowed usage) | ||||
| * | fontgen: added missing requested font check |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-0/+6 |
| | | |||||
| * | fontgen: Added ability to choose fonts with .c |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-1/+11 |
| | | |||||
| * | Added FontAwesome5-Solid+Brands+Regular.woff to git | Yehoshua Pesach Wallach | 2022-05-10 | 1 | -0/+0 |
| | | |||||
| * | Added font auto-generate script | Yehoshua Pesach Wallach | 2022-05-10 | 3 | -0/+190 |
| | | |||||
| * | Replace airplane mode with a bluetooth toggle | Riku Isokoski | 2022-04-02 | 2 | -43/+31 |
| | | |||||
| * | Update navigation font readme section | Riku Isokoski | 2022-03-08 | 2 | -11/+7 |
| | | |||||
| * | Add ExtraBold font ttf | Riku Isokoski | 2022-03-08 | 1 | -0/+0 |
| | | |||||
| * | Further updates to font readme. | Riku Isokoski | 2022-03-08 | 3 | -385/+416 |
| | | |||||
